Menno Bergsen is a 26-year-old football player who plays as a keeper for Helmond Sport, born on August 26, 1999. Follow Menno Bergsen on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.
In the 2025/2026 Eerste Divisie season, Menno Bergsen has recorded 3,194 minutes, an average FotMob rating of 6.62, 3 yellow cards.
Menno Bergsen scores highly on Matches, Started, and Clean sheets compared to keepers in the Eerste Divisie.

Menno Bergsen's career has also included time at Maribor, Trencin, FC Eindhoven, and FC Dordrecht.

Throughout their career, Menno Bergsen has won 1 title: 1. SNL (2021/2022) with Maribor.
